electron-webrtc icon indicating copy to clipboard operation
electron-webrtc copied to clipboard

Electron error: ConnectDataChannel called when data_channel_ is NULL.

Open paulkernfeld opened this issue 8 years ago • 0 comments

This happened once while I was trying to connect two local peers with one another (via the webrtc-swarm library). I think this is an error from the stderr output of the Electron process. OSX, node 6.3.0, electron-prebuilt 0.37.8, electron-webrtc 0.2.5. Can I provide any additional information about this? Unfortunately I can't figure out what were the specific conditions that led to this; it seemed to be a random failure.

Error: Child process stderr output [2134:0716/083803:ERROR:webrtcsession.cc(1388)] ConnectDataChannel called when data_channel_ is NULL.
,[2127:0716/083803:FATAL:webrtc_identity_store_backend.cc(413)] Check failed: stmt.is_valid().
0   Electron Framework                  0x0000000107ce76a3 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 397715
1   Electron Framework                  0x0000000107cfe769 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 492121
2   Electron Framework                  0x00000001085cb868 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 9720664
3   Electron Framework                  0x0000000107d38c07 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 730871
4   Electron Framework                  0x0000000107ce7bcb _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 399035
5   Electron Framework                  0x0000000107d08633 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 532771
6   Electron Framework                  0x0000000107d0894c _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 533564
7   Electron Framework                  0x0000000107d08b3b _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 534059
8   Electron Framework                  0x0000000107cdd5f1 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 356577
9   Electron Framework                  0x0000000107cff18a _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 494714
10  Electron Framework                  0x0000000107cdcff4 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 355044
11  CoreFoundation                      0x00007fff98386a01 __CFRUNLOOP_IS_CALLING_OUT_TO_A_SOURCE0_PERFORM_FUNCTION__ + 17
12  CoreFoundation                      0x00007fff98378b8d __CFRunLoopDoSources0 + 269
13  CoreFoundation                      0x00007fff983781bf __CFRunLoopRun + 927
14  CoreFoundation                      0x00007fff98377bd8 CFRunLoopRunSpecific + 296
15  Electron Framework                  0x0000000107cdd9bf _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 357551
16  Electron Framework                  0x0000000107cdd444 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 356148
17  Electron Framework                  0x0000000107d1d0e3 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 617427
18  Electron Framework                  0x0000000107d07ddd _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 530637
19  Electron Framework                  0x000000010842fe08 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 8034552
20  Electron Framework                  0x0000000108430217 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 8035591
21  Electron Framework                  0x0000000107d3c6b8 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 745896
22  Electron Framework                  0x0000000107d389b7 _ZN4base8internal30DstRangeRelationToSrcRangeImplIilLNS0_21IntegerRepresentationE1ELS2_1ELNS0_26NumericRangeRepresentationE0EE5CheckEl + 730279
23  libsystem_pthread.dylib             0x00007fff94a1605a _pthread_body + 131
24  libsystem_pthread.dylib             0x00007fff94a15fd7 _pthread_body + 0
25  libsystem_pthread.dylib             0x00007fff94a133ed thread_start + 13


    at /Users/paul/repos/electron-eval/lib/index.js:139:32
    at /Users/paul/repos/electron-eval/node_modules/stream-to-array/index.js:54:9
    at _combinedTickCallback (internal/process/next_tick.js:67:7)
    at process._tickCallback (internal/process/next_tick.js:98:9)

paulkernfeld avatar Jul 16 '16 12:07 paulkernfeld